The current name of the book is "This Can't Be Happening" and he wrote it when he was 11. It was originaly titled "This Can't Be Happening at Macdonald Hall" It is part of the Macdonald Hall series which consists of: 1. This Can't Be Happening 2. Go Jump In The Pool 3. Beware Of The Fish 4. The Wizzle War 5. The Zucchini Warriors 6. Lights, Camera, Disaster 7. The Joke's On Us

As a child, Gordon Korman enjoyed writing and telling stories. He wrote his first book, "This Can't Be Happening at Macdonald Hall," when he was just 12 years old. He continued to pursue writing throughout his teenage years and eventually became a successful author of middle-grade and young adult novels.
